Fedora 42: CEF High CVE-2026-0628 Insufficient Policy Enforcement Advisory

Update to 143.0.7499.192 [rhbz#2427842] *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Fedora Update Notification FEDORA-2026-2a94cc43d9 2026-01-21 01:30:15.162802+00:00 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Name : cef Product : Fedora 42 Version : 143.0.13^chromium143.0.7499.192 Release : 1.fc42 URL : https://bitbucket.org/chromiumembedded/cef Summary : Chromium Embedded Framework Description : CEF is an embeddable build of Chromium, powered by WebKit (Blink). -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Update Information: Update to 143.0.7499.192 [rhbz#2427842] *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ChangeLog: * Fri Jan 9 2026 Than Ngo - 143.0.13^chromium143.0.7499.192-1 - Update to 143.0.7499.192 [rhbz#2427842] - *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ag - Fix rhbz#2425338, Enable control flow integrity support for x86_64/aarch64 - Enable build for epel10.1 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- References: [ 1 ] Bug #2427842 - cef-143.0.14 is available https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2427842 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- This update can be installed with the "dnf" update program. Use su -c 'dnf upgrade --advisory FEDORA-2026-2a94cc43d9' at the command line. For more information, refer to the dnf documentation available at http://dnf.readthedocs.io/en/latest/command_ref.html#upgrade-command-label All packages are signed with the Fedora Project GPG key. Fedora 42: Chromium High Insufficient Policy Enforcement CVE-2026-0628

Update to 143.0.7499.192 *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ag * Enable control flow integrity support for x86_64/aarch64 * Enable build for epel10.1.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Fedora Update Notification FEDORA-2026-540f5a89d1 2026-01-12 01:08:34.524851+00:00 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Name : chromium Product : Fedora 42 Version : 143.0.7499.192 Release : 1.fc42 URL : http://www.chromium.org/Home Summary : A WebKit (Blink) powered web browser that Google doesn't want you to use Description : Chromium is an open-source web browser, powered by WebKit (Blink). -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Update Information: Update to 143.0.7499.192 *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ag * Enable control flow integrity support for x86_64/aarch64 * Enable build for epel10.1 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ChangeLog: * Wed Jan 7 2026 Than Ngo - 143.0.7499.192-1 - Update tp 143.0.7499.192 * High CVE-2026-0628: Insufficient policy enforcement in WebView tag - Fix rhbz#2425338, Enable control flow integrity support for x86_64/aarch64 - Enable build for epel10.1 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- References: [ 1 ] Bug #2425338 - Please re-enable CFI build option https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2425338 [ 2 ] Bug #2425439 - Chromium not updated RHEL 10 https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2425439 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- This update can be installed with the "dnf" update program. Use su -c 'dnf upgrade --advisory FEDORA-2026-540f5a89d1' at the command line. For more information, refer to the dnf documentation availableat http://dnf.readthedocs.io/en/latest/command_ref.html#upgrade-command-label All packages are signed with the Fedora Project GPG key. openSUSE: Chromium Important Fix for 2025:0232-1 CVE-2025-6554

An update that fixes four vulnerabilities is now available. . openSUSE Security Update: Security update for chromium ______________________________________________________________________________ Announcement ID: openSUSE-SU-2025:0232-1 Rating: important References: #1245332 #1245544 Cross-References: CVE-2025-6554 CVE-2025-6555 CVE-2025-6556 CVE-2025-6557 Affected Products: openSUSE Backports SLE-15-SP7 ______________________________________________________________________________ An update that fixes four vulnerabilities is now available. Description: this update for chromium 138.0.7204.96 (stable released 2025-06-30) (boo#1245544) fixes the following issues: * cve-2025-6554: type confusion in v8 * CVE-2025-6555: Use after free in Animation * CVE-2025-6556: Insufficient policy enforcement in Loader * CVE-2025-6557: Insufficient data validation in DevTools Patch Instructions: To install this openSU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ch". openSUSE: 2020:0823-1 Important: Chromium Security Update - 32 Issues Fixed

An update that fixes 32 vulnerabilities is now available.. openSUSE Security Update: Security update for chromium ______________________________________________________________________________ Announcement ID: openSUSE-SU-2020:0823-1 Rating: important References: #1170107 #1171910 #1171975 #1172496 Cross-References: CVE-2020-6463 CVE-2020-6465 CVE-2020-6466 CVE-2020-6467 CVE-2020-6468 CVE-2020-6469 CVE-2020-6470 CVE-2020-6471 CVE-2020-6472 CVE-2020-6473 CVE-2020-6474 CVE-2020-6475 CVE-2020-6476 CVE-2020-6477 CVE-2020-6478 CVE-2020-6479 CVE-2020-6480 CVE-2020-6481 CVE-2020-6482 CVE-2020-6483 CVE-2020-6484 CVE-2020-6485 CVE-2020-6486 CVE-2020-6487 CVE-2020-6488 CVE-2020-6489 CVE-2020-6490 CVE-2020-6491 CVE-2020-6493 CVE-2020-6494 CVE-2020-6495 CVE-2020-6496 Affected Products: openSUSE Leap 15.1 ______________________________________________________________________________ An update that fixes 32 vulnerabilities is now available. Description: This update for chromium fixes the following issues: Chromium was updated to 83.0.4103.97 (boo#1171910,bsc#1172496): * CVE-2020-6463: Use after free in ANGLE (boo#1170107 boo#1171975). * CVE-2020-6465: Use after free in reader mode. Reported by Woojin Oh(@pwn_expoit) of STEALIEN on 2020-04-21 * CVE-2020-6466: Use after free in media. Reported by Zhe Jin from cdsrc of Qihoo 360 on 2020-04-26 * CVE-2020-6467: Use after free in WebRTC. Reported by ZhanJia Song on 2020-04-06 * CVE-2020-6468: Type Confusion in V8. Reported by Chris Salls and Jake Corina of Seaside Security, Chani Jindal of Shellphish on 2020-04-30 * CVE-2020-6469: Insufficient policy enforcement in developer tools. Reported by David Erceg on 2020-04-02 * CVE-2020-6470: Insufficient validation of untrustedinput in clipboard. Reported by Michał Bentkowski of Securitum on 2020-03-30 * CVE-2020-6471: Insufficient policy enforcement in developer tools. Reported by David Erceg on 2020-03-08 * CVE-2020-6472: Insufficient policy enforcement in developer tools. Reported by David Erceg on 2020-03-25 * CVE-2020-6473: Insufficient policy enforcement in Blink. Reported by Soroush Karami and Panagiotis Ilia on 2020-02-06 * CVE-2020-6474: Use after free in Blink. Reported by Zhe Jin from cdsrc of Qihoo 360 on 2020-03-07 * CVE-2020-6475: Incorrect security UI in full screen. Reported by Khalil Zhani on 2019-10-31 * CVE-2020-6476: Insufficient policy enforcement in tab strip. Reported by Alexandre Le Borgne on 2019-12-18 * CVE-2020-6477: Inappropriate implementation in installer. Reported by RACK911 Labs on 2019-03-26 * CVE-2020-6478: Inappropriate implementation in full screen. Reported by Khalil Zhani on 2019-12-24 * CVE-2020-6479: Inappropriate implementation in sharing. Reported by Zhong Zhaochen of andsecurity.cn on 2020-01-14 * CVE-2020-6480: Insufficient policy enforcement in enterprise. Reported by Marvin Witt on 2020-02-21 * CVE-2020-6481: Insufficient policy enforcement in URL formatting. Reported by Rayyan Bijoora on 2020-04-07 * CVE-2020-6482: Insufficient policy enforcement in developer tools. Reported by Abdulrahman Alqabandi (@qab) on 2017-12-17 * CVE-2020-6483: Insufficient policy enforcement in payments. Reported by Jun Kokatsu, Microsoft Browser Vulnerability Research on 2019-05-23 * CVE-2020-6484: Insufficient data validation in ChromeDriver. Reported by Artem Zinenko on 2020-01-26 * CVE-2020-6485: Insufficient data validation in media router. Reported by Sergei Glazunov of Google Project Zero on 2020-01-30 * CVE-2020-6486: Insufficient policy enforcement in navigations. Reported by David Erceg on 2020-02-24 * CVE-2020-6487: Insufficient policy enforcement in downloads.Reported by Jun Kokatsu (@shhnjk) on 2015-10-06 * CVE-2020-6488: Insufficient policy enforcement in downloads. Reported by David Erceg on 2020-01-21 * CVE-2020-6489: Inappropriate implementation in developer tools. Reported by @lovasoa (Ophir LOJKINE) on 2020-02-10 * CVE-2020-6490: Insufficient data validation in loader. Reported by Twitter on 2019-12-19 * CVE-2020-6491: Incorrect security UI in site information. Reported by Sultan Haikal M.A on 2020-02-07 * CVE-2020-6493: Use after free in WebAuthentication. * CVE-2020-6494: Incorrect security UI in payments. * CVE-2020-6495: Insufficient policy enforcement in developer tools. * CVE-2020-6496: Use after free in payments. Patch Instructions: To install this openSU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ch".
